Abstract
The utility model discloses a profiled steel sheet composite floor, including profiled sheet, concrete slab, socket cap cant chisei and girder steel, the profiled sheet is laid in the top of girder steel, the profiled sheet with through socket cap cant chisei fixed connection between the girder steel, the profiled sheet sets up in concrete slab's below, the profiled sheet is the trapezoidal steel sheet of open type, be provided with a plurality of ascending trapezoidal archs on the profiled sheet. The profiled sheet forms the dovetail groove between adjacent two trapezoidal archs. The utility model discloses can improve traditional floor bearing capacity, mechanics, anti -seismic performance are good, accord with the engineering actual need.

Background technology
Along with steel building is in a large amount of rises of China, multi and tall steel building building is high with its intensity, deadweight
Gently, anti-seismic performance is good, speed of application is fast, ground cost saving, area occupied is little, industrialization degree is high, outer
The number of advantages such as shape is attractive in appearance, environmental protection are increasingly by various places government, large-scale steel structure company and real estate
The attention of developer.And in multi and tall steel building architectural engineering, the selection of floor system be one important
Link, superior floor system should possess that intensity is high, good from heavy and light, anti-seismic performance, short construction period, work
Industry degree high.In conventional engineering, conventional floor pattern has cast-in-place concrete floor, pre-
Superimposed sheet, two-way multi-ribbed plate on stress coagulation, and the following shortcoming of these floor systems person of existence:
1, cast-in-place concrete floor: floor, from great, need to carry out formwork, form removal, and construction bothers, and
Formwork seal is poor, is easily generated slurry phenomenon of pouring, long construction period.
2, prestressed concrete overlapped slab: be half prefabricated half cast-in-place owing to using, transport, stack the most square
Just, site operation arranges underaction, and the position in-situ processing such as bearing, plate lap-joint is cumbersome.
3, two-way multi-ribbed plate: require higher to template, construction trouble, stress is complicated, is easily generated weak point
Position.
Based on above situation, applicant's incorporation engineering is put into practice, and absorbs recent domestic scientific research, designs, executes
The achievement that work provides a reference, develops profiled steel sheet combination floor.
